We did an tour from the pier across from the Market in Manous. We were meet and escorted with an english speaking guide. It was wonderful, an all day tour on a comfortable ferry for about 40 people. They took us to swim with the dolphins, visit with a local tribe where we bought many handcrafts at reasonable prices. Lunch was included which was great, an open self service buffet with a bountiful spread, LOTS to choose from! You only paid for drinks/Beverage. Also a short canopy walk on a raised walkway and then to see where the Amazon River meets Rio Negro. Not much walking basically on & off the boat. Left at 8am got back about 4pm. The Craft market is also great across the street from the pier at the market!

Visa needed for Brazil, not a problem just get it from the Brazilian Embassy or Consulate or the WWW good for 2 years and less then $100 unless you use the WWW and go to a Visa Provider to get the visa, cheaper if you go directly (in person) to a Brazilian Embassy or Consulate but no everyone has one nearby! First go to the www to see EXACTLY what you need to have before you go to apply. Get it about 30 days before you leave takes 3-4 days but can take a week. If anyone is going to Argentina a visa will also be needed go to the www and read what you need

Using the Train in Italy is easy all the major cities have connections to Civitavecchia, depending where you're coming from you may have to connect in Rome Termini station. There are express trains from Civitavecchia to Florence or Siena in less then 3 hours, 2.5 hours to Pisa and Venice a little more then 4 hours. Local trains are about 1.5 hours longer but at half the cost. Many Buses are also direct and cheaper then the train, often the terminals are next door to each other. BAD bus connections from most places to Civitavecchia, no buses from Airport to the port but easy by train, you can take express or local trains (Cheaper) and transfer, avoiding going to Termini.

Been to all the ports, Valencia is a GEM! Outstanding city with modern architecture had a Riverbed that went dry 100's of years ago became a upscale Avenue with Parks, Concert Halls, Gardens and Bridges that are outstanding. Good food too! Cathedral is nice and the city is easy to navigate, good train connections and buses.
